Mastering the ADI Part 3: A Strategic Perspective for Success

Aspiring driving instructors often find the ADI Part 3 test to be a daunting hurdle on their path to certification. This final stage demands not only comprehensive knowledge of driving instruction principles but also the ability to demonstrate them effectively under the scrutiny of an examiner. In the video "Don't Fail The ADI Part 3 - See things how the examiner does," crucial insights are shared to help candidates approach the test with confidence and competence.

Understanding the Examiner's Perspective

One of the key takeaways from the video is the importance of viewing the test through the eyes of the examiner. Recognizing what they're looking for enables candidates to tailor their performance accordingly. Examiners assess not only instructional ability but also professionalism, communication skills, and adherence to the DVSA's standards.

Strategic Preparation

Preparation is the cornerstone of success in the ADI Part 3. Beyond mastering the content, candidates must strategically prepare for the format and expectations of the test. This involves practicing instructional techniques, anticipating common scenarios, and refining communication skills. The video offers valuable tips on structuring lessons, managing time effectively, and maintaining composure under pressure.

Effective Communication Techniques

Effective communication lies at the heart of driving instruction. In the video, candidates are encouraged to focus on clear, concise communication that resonates with learners of all abilities. Active listening, positive reinforcement, and the ability to adapt teaching methods to suit individual learning styles are emphasized as key strategies for success.

Demonstrating Competence

Demonstrating competence goes beyond mere instruction; it involves creating a conducive learning environment, fostering rapport with learners, and instilling confidence through encouragement and constructive feedback. The video underscores the importance of demonstrating professionalism, empathy, and adaptability throughout the test.
